HOW TO TRAVEL BY BUS
How do you take the bus? And what do you need to travel on it? busDue to ever-increasing prices and frequent train delays, buses have gradually gained prominence among travelers, both for business and pleasure. Not to mention that not all towns are served by rail, which forces us to opt for at least one bus connection between the train station and our destination.
How to travel by busIt's simple and accessible to everyone. And, with a few small adjustments, you can spend pleasant hours even while sitting. How?
- If you have the opportunity, occupy the seats further forward, those close to the driver from which you can have a better view and also have more space available. Furthermore, the seats at the end of the vehicle are not suitable for those who suffer from car sickness.
- To deal with this common discomfort, carry around some chewing gum or classic medical aids based on xamamine, such as the anti-inflammatory patch. car sickness.
- Keep at least one packet of crackers in your bag, useful for fighting hunger and nausea, and one bottle of water.
- Take advantage of the breaks to get off the vehicle or even just get up and stretch your legs. Traffic will thank you, and you'll have managed to get some fresh air. Especially if you still have many kilometers to go.
- Bring along a tablets for watch a movie or watch a documentary during the journey, you won't get bored. If you don't mind reading while the bus is moving, a useful one is book or an ebook reader.
- Finally, a piece of advice on how to sleep on a busIf possible, lower the backrest to create a reclining position, perfect for a nap. Alternatively, use traditional neck pillows, which will support you even when you're sitting.
As you can see, you don't need much to travel in bus numbers: all you need is your ticket in paper or electronic format and nothing more.

LOW COST BUSES
Among the many advantages of traveling by bus, besides safety (there are far fewer highway accidents involving buses than other means of transport), is also its affordability. The bus is low cost, and allows you to save significantly on transport whatever the nature of your trip. bus travel prices They are affordable for all budgets, whether for commuters or tourists, young or old. As well as for those who love backpacking. Offering particularly economical rates, they manage to provide a low budget alternative to the planes and ships. Without compromising on service, however. The latest generation of vehicles are increasingly comfortable and well-connected.
HOW DO I FIND BUS TRAVEL DEALS?
The bus travel sector works, broadly speaking, like the airline industry. Here too, we have a series of options available. company who draw up their own price list. And who offer quite a few quote, which you can take advantage of by booking in advance. But also last minute, depending on the time of year and availability. Just to give you an idea, you could find yourself traveling from L'Aquila to Rome for less than 5 euros a trip. How?
Booking online it is possible to purchase a bus travel at the best priceBy setting your departure city, arrival city, and date, you'll be able to see all the available options with their respective prices. You can then compare the various daily rates or, if you don't have any particular date requirements, you can also view those for the days immediately preceding or following your trip, to find the best deal. most advantageous solution.
There are also sites that act as collectors of Best Deals available, grouping the main companies of bus numbersThey offer a convenient, free, and efficient service. Low-cost bus 1 Euro? It may happen that, in view of the launch of a new route, or as the holidays approach, some companies offer tickets, perhaps on popular routes (naturally within Italy), at this price.

FLIXBUS
Flixbus is a low-cost bus company based in GermanyIts strong point is the large number of routes it offers, capable of connecting the main Italian and European cities at very advantageous prices.
ITABUS
Italian – as can be deduced from the name – is instead itabusThis is a relatively recently established private long-distance company. It offers fares starting from €1,99 and over 400 daily connections from north to south, on both the Tyrrhenian and Adriatic coasts.
TERRAVISION
Terravision It primarily handles connections to and from Italian airports (which, after all, are part of a vacation). Its strong point is the frequency and affordability of its flights. It operates throughout Europe and is convenient for those who need to get from the airport to begin their trip.
AUTOSTRADALE
Last, but not least, is the Highway company. Founded in 1924, with headquarters in Milan, it is among the first Italian transport companies to have promoted bus transport. It offers many advantages, including convenient subscription plans for various categories of travellers.
